Gadekar K, Kibriya SZ, Kulkarni P, Balasubramanian S. Efficacy of Low-Dose Streptokinase Infusion in Late-Onset Permanent Tunnel Catheter Dysfunction: A Single-Center Interventional Study. Cureus 2024; 16:e58028. [PMID: 38738061 PMCID: PMC11088470 DOI: 10.7759/cureus.58028]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/29/2024] [Accepted: 04/11/2024] [Indexed: 05/14/2024] Open
Abstract
Introduction Hemodialysis is a vital modality for patients with renal dysfunction, with venous access being a significant factor in its success. While arteriovenous fistulas are preferred, tunneled catheters serve as important alternatives, especially in challenging cases. Late-onset tunneled catheter dysfunction, often due to fibrin sheath formation, impedes hemodialysis efficiency. Streptokinase, a low-cost thrombolytic agent, has shown promise in resolving such complications, yet its efficacy in the Indian context remains unexplored. Methods We conducted a single-center interventional study at Mahatma Gandhi Mission (MGM) Hospital, Aurangabad, India, from May 2023 to October 2023. Ethical approval was obtained, and 10 eligible patients experiencing late-onset permanent tunnel catheter dysfunction were enrolled. Patients were treated with low-dose streptokinase, and outcomes were monitored for 60 days. Results Ten patients, evenly distributed by gender, participated, with a mean age of 48.2 ± 11.96 years. Diabetes was the predominant cause of chronic kidney disease (CKD) at 33% (3/10). All patients achieved the primary endpoint of blood flow rate (BFR) >300 ml/min post-streptokinase treatment, with an overall success rate of 100%. Group A had the highest average gain in catheter days (80.6 ± 7.59), followed by Group B (64 ± 1), while Group C showed variations in catheter days between the first (26.2 ± 6.8) and second insertion (32.5 ± 1.76). Eight patients maintained catheter patency during the 60-day follow-up. Adverse effects, primarily minor, were observed. The dosage rationale involved an eight-hour infusion at 4,000 units per hour. Conclusion Streptokinase emerges as cost-effective and efficacious for maintaining the patency of late-onset tunnel catheter dysfunction in resource-limited settings, particularly in younger patients. Caution is advised for older individuals with prolonged CKD.

Fan Y, He D, Cheng J, Wu Z, Hao Y, Liu H. Successful Removal and Replacement of a Stuck Hemodialysis Catheter via Thoracotomy: Report of Two Cases and Literature Review. Case Rep Nephrol Dial 2024; 14:56-63. [PMID: 38571812 PMCID: PMC10990479 DOI: 10.1159/000537740]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/05/2023] [Accepted: 02/01/2024] [Indexed: 04/05/2024] Open
Abstract
Introduction Stuck tunneled central venous catheters (CVCs) have been increasingly reported. In rare cases, the impossibility of extracting the CVC from the central vein after regular traction is the result of rigid adhesions to the surrounding fibrin sheath. Forced traction during catheter removal can cause serious complications, including cardiac tamponade, hemothorax, and hemorrhagic shock. Knowledge and experience on how to properly manage the stuck catheter are still limited. Case Presentation Here, we present two cases that highlight the successful removal of the stuck tunneled CVC via thoracotomy through the close collaboration of multidisciplinary specialists in the best possible way. Both patients underwent an unsuccessful attempt at thrombolytic therapy with urokinase, catheter traction under the guidance of digital subtraction angiography and intraluminal balloon dilation. And we reviewed the literature on stuck catheters in the hope of providing knowledge and effective approaches to attempted removal of stuck catheters. Conclusion There is no standardized procedure for dealing with stuck catheters. Intraluminal percutaneous transluminal angioplasty should be considered as the first-line treatment, while open surgery represents a second option only in the event of failure. Care must be taken that forced extubation can cause patients life-threatening.

金 骊, 王 慧, 崔 天, 廖 若. [Catheter Replacement Methods in Hemodialysis Patients With Dysfunctional Tunneled-Cuffed Catheters With Fibrin Sheaths]. SICHUAN DA XUE XUE BAO. YI XUE BAN = JOURNAL OF SICHUAN UNIVERSITY. MEDICAL SCIENCE EDITION 2023; 54:1283-1287. [PMID: 38162080 PMCID: PMC10752794 DOI: 10.12182/20231160201]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 08/22/2023] [Indexed: 01/03/2024]
Abstract
Objective Tunneled-cuffed catheters (TCCs) are frequently used for establishing hemodialysis access for maintenance hemodialysis in older patients with exhausted resources of peripheral vessels. Fibrin sheath formation around the catheter is one of the most common complications of long-term use of indwelling catheter, which may cause the malfunction of the catheter. In this study, we intend to compare the prognosis of two catheter replacement methods, in situ replacement and replacement through a fibrin sheath crevice, with both being assisted by balloon dilation, and to explore the optimal catheter replacement process. Methods A retrospective study was conducted with 52 patients who underwent a replacement of their TCCs. Among them, 27 cases had their TCC replaced by the modified method of replacement through a fibrin sheath crevice and were referred to as the sheath crevice group, while 25 cases underwent in situ catheter replacement and were referred to as the in situ group. The primary outcome indicators included maximum blood flow in hemodialysis catheter and the urea clearance rate calculated by Kt/V values at the 1, 3, and 6-month follow-ups. The secondary outcomes included dialyzer alarms being set off and catheter-related infections during follow-up. Results There was no significant difference between the general data of the two groups. There was no massive blood loss during the replacement procedure. Neither were there cardiac tamponade, catheter-associated infections, or other complications. Follow-ups were made 1, 3, and 6 months after the replacement procedure. The sheath crevice group had higher catheter blood flow and Kt/V values at the 6-month follow-up than the in situ group did ([241.85±9.62] mL/min vs. [234.40±11.21] mL/min, P=0.014 and 1.31±0.55 vs. 1.27±0.49, P=0.005, respectively). During the follow-up process, access alarms were reported in 5 patients (three in the in situ group and two in the sheath crevice group) during dialysis. No catheter-associated infection occurred in either group. Conclusion The catheter replacement method of balloon dilation-assisted catheter insertion through a fibrin sheath crevice is safe and effective, resulting in better long-term catheter blood flow compared with that of in situ catheter replacement.

Bau JT, Younis K, Gallagher N, Harrison TG, Leung K, Hemmett J, Qirjazi E. Reduction in Thrombolytic Usage in Hemodialysis Patients Following a Quality Assurance Review: A Research Letter. Can J Kidney Health Dis 2023; 10:20543581231174276. [PMID: 37251299 PMCID: PMC10214048 DOI: 10.1177/20543581231174276]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/24/2023] [Accepted: 04/05/2023] [Indexed: 05/31/2023] Open
Abstract
Background Catheter malfunction in hemodialysis (HD) is increasingly managed with recombinant tissue plasminogen activator (rt-PA, alteplase), though evidence of improved catheter function is lacking. Objective To evaluate the effect of a standardized rt-PA administration protocol on rt-PA usage, catheter function, and adverse events. Design Observational quality improvement study. Setting Single, urban, community HD unit in Calgary, Alberta. Patients Patients treated with maintenance in-center HD through central venous catheter. Outcomes Incidence of rt-PA usage, catheter interventions, hospitalizations, and measures of dialysis efficacy. Methods The rt-PA protocol was designed following a consultative and iterative design period with dialysis shareholders, which included focusing on standard objective criteria before use and targeting use to the problematic lumen. Protocol implementation occurred over a 6-month period in 2021. Patient and dialysis data were collected through our regional dialysis electronic health record. Results Implementation of the rt-PA protocol resulted in decreased rt-PA use (standardized per 100 dialysis sessions) compared to the preprotocol period (incidence rate ratio [IRR] of 0.57, 95% confidence interval [CI]: [0.34, 0.94]). Line procedures were also less frequent (IRR = 0.42, 95% CI: [0.18, 0.89]). Hospitalization rates and measures of dialysis efficacy were similar in both periods. Limitations Small sample size with single dialysis center and short duration of follow-up. Conclusions Implementation of a multidisciplinary designed rt-PA administration protocol decreased incident rt-PA usage.

Locked Away-Prophylaxis and Management of Catheter Related Thrombosis in Hemodialysis. J Clin Med 2021; 10:jcm10112230. [PMID: 34063913 PMCID: PMC8196553 DOI: 10.3390/jcm10112230]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/11/2021] [Accepted: 05/18/2021] [Indexed: 11/17/2022] Open
Abstract
Reliable vascular access is necessary for effective hemodialysis. Guidelines recommend chronic hemodialysis via an arteriovenous fistula (AVF), however, in a significant number of patients, permanent central venous catheters (CVCs) are used. The use of a tunneled catheter is acceptable if the estimated dialysis time is less than a year or it is not possible to create an AVF. The main complications associated with CVC include thrombosis and catheter-related bloodstream infections (CRBSIs), which may result in loss of vascular access. The common practice is to use locking solutions to maintain catheter patency and minimize the risk of CRBSI. This paperwork summarizes information on currently available locking solutions for dialysis catheters along with their effectiveness in preventing thrombotic and infectious complications and describes methods of dealing with catheter dysfunction. The PubMed database was systematically searched for articles about locking solutions used in permanent CVCs in hemodialysis patients. Additional studies were identified by searching bibliographies and international guidelines. Articles on end-stage kidney disease patients dialyzed through a permanent CVC were included. Information from each primary study was extracted using pre-determined criteria including thrombotic and infectious complications of CVC use, focusing on permanent CVC if sufficient data were available. Of the currently available substances, it seems that citrate at a concentration of 4% has the best cost-effectiveness and safety profile, which is reflected in the international guidelines. Recent studies suggest the advantage of 2+1 protocols, i.e., taurolidine-based solutions with addition of urokinase once a week, although it needs to be confirmed by further research. Regardless of the type of locking solution, if prophylaxis with a thrombolytic agent is chosen, it should be started from the very beginning to reduce the risk of thrombotic complications. In case of CVC dysfunction, irrespective of the thrombolysis attempt, catheter replacement should be planned as soon as possible.

Lichtenstein T, Mammadov K, Rau K, Große Hokamp N, Do TD, Maintz D, Chang DH. Long-Term Follow-Up and Clinical Relevance of Incidental Findings of Fibrin Sheath and Thrombosis on Computed Tomography Scans of Cancer Patients with Port Catheters. Ther Clin Risk Manag 2021; 17:111-118. [PMID: 33536758 PMCID: PMC7850422 DOI: 10.2147/tcrm.s287544]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/22/2020] [Accepted: 01/11/2021] [Indexed: 01/21/2023] Open
Abstract
Purpose This retrospective study examined the incidence, progression, and clinical relevance of catheter-related thrombosis (CRT) and/or fibrin sheaths presenting as incidental findings on routine staging computed tomography (CT) scans performed in cancer patients. Patients and Methods Patients who underwent central venous port catheter (CVC) placement in a tertiary care hospital between September 2010 and August 2013 were followed up for up to five years. Two radiologists assessed the presence of fibrin sheath and thrombosis in consensus in staging CT scan. Patient demographics, type of cancer, preoperative comorbidities, date of CVC placement and CTs, preexisting anticoagulation, as well as the type and treatment of catheter-related complications were determined from the electronic medical record. Results A total of 194 patients with 530 CT scans and a mean follow-up time of 394 days were included. Fibrin sheaths and thromboses were seen on 46 scans (8.7%) in 30 patients and 80 scans (15.1%) in 35 patients. The incidence of fibrin sheaths and thromboses was found to be 15.5% and 18%, respectively. The comparison to initial CT reports results indicated that fibrin sheaths or thromboses were missed in 106 examinations (20%). Catheter-associated complications were reported in 14 patients (21.5%) without specific therapy. Conclusion Fibrin sheaths and CRTs are often overlooked on routine CT scans when patients are asymptomatic. The subsequent high complication rate demonstrates the clinical relevance of the initial incidental finding on CT scan. Further studies should elucidate the effect of thrombolytic agents and interventional radiologic treatment in asymptomatic patients.

Yongchun H, Hua J, Xiaohan H, Jianghua C, Ping Z. Solutions to stuck tunneled cuffed catheters in patients undergoing maintenance hemodialysis. J Vasc Access 2020; 22:203-208. [PMID: 32588722 DOI: 10.1177/1129729820928163]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/15/2022] Open
Abstract
OBJECTIVE To study and discuss treatments for stuck tunneled cuffed catheter in patients undergoing maintenance hemodialysis. METHOD Retrospectively analyzing clinical data of 13 patients with stuck tunneled cuffed catheter in the Kidney Disease Center of the First Affiliated Hospital, College of Medicine, Zhejiang University in the period between September 2012 and October 2018. All patients failed to remove hemodialysis catheters by regular technique. The stuck catheters were treated by thoracotomy, endoluminal percutaneous transluminal angioplasty with blunt dissection or embedded and left in situ. RESULTS In 13 patients, one was successfully treated by thoracotomy, one failed to remove the catheter by regular technique and blunt dissection, and the stump of the catheter was clamped and buried in the subcutaneous fascia of the neck, and the other 11 were treated by endoluminal percutaneous transluminal angioplasty with blunt dissection. The average time of catheter removal procedure is 25 min, the overall success rate is 92.3%, and the success rate of percutaneous transluminal angioplasty is 100%. CONCLUSION Thoracotomy is an efficient way to treat stuck catheter but is limited by its high risk and complications. Leaving part of catheter in situ may increase the risk of central vein stenosis. Comparing to the former two, endoluminal percutaneous transluminal angioplasty is a safe, efficient, and practical way for stuck catheters and should be recommended as the first choice.

Franchi M, Parissone F, Lazzari C, Garzon S, Laganà AS, Raffaelli R, Cromi A, Ghezzi F. Selective use of episiotomy: what is the impact on perineal trauma? Results from a retrospective cohort study. Arch Gynecol Obstet 2019; 301:427-435. [PMID: 31823037 DOI: 10.1007/s00404-019-05404-5] [Citation(s) in RCA: 19] [Impact Index Per Article: 3.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/21/2019] [Accepted: 12/02/2019] [Indexed: 11/24/2022]
Abstract
PURPOSE To evaluate the effects of selective use of episiotomy on perineal trauma. METHODS We performed a retrospective cohort study on consecutive vaginal deliveries from January 2010 to December 2016. From January 2010 to December 2011 episiotomy was performed liberally, based only on individual midwife/doctor's decision. Since January 2012, a shared selective use of episiotomy policy has been introduced. To evaluate the range of perineal trauma in spontaneous second-degree perineal tears, a sub-classification of second-degree lacerations has been introduced dividing them into two sub-groups: A (smaller than the average episiotomy) and B (spontaneous vaginal tear larger than the average episiotomy). The primary outcomes were the incidence and type of perineal trauma, with the proportion of type A and type B second-degree spontaneous tears under a policy of selective episiotomy. RESULTS Deliveries not exposed to selective use of episiotomy were 1583 (Group 1), those exposed to selective use of episiotomy were 6409 (Group 2). In Group 2 episiotomy rate decreased, and incidence of intact perineum, first- and second-degree lacerations increased. The incidence of third- and fourth-degree lacerations did not change. Spontaneous second-degree lacerations occurred in 19.4% and 36.8% of women in group 1 and 2, respectively. With a selective episiotomy policy, 88.3% of second-degree tears was classified as type A. CONCLUSIONS The selective use of episiotomy is clinically feasible and effective. This policy seems to be associated with a lower delivery-related perineal trauma as showed by the sub-classification, that could be a useful tool to monitor obstetric care.

TuLIP (Tunnelled Line Intraluminal Plasty): An Alternative Technique for Salvaging Haemodialysis Catheter Patency in Fibrin Sheath Formation. Cardiovasc Intervent Radiol 2019; 42:770-774. [PMID: 30824945 PMCID: PMC6435624 DOI: 10.1007/s00270-019-02189-7]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/13/2018] [Accepted: 02/18/2019] [Indexed: 11/05/2022]
Abstract
Background Renal patients with a tunnelled haemodialysis line are at risk of fibrin ‘sheath’ formation which can lead to occlusion. Dysfunctional lines are best treated by catheter exchange with a new subcutaneous tunnel; however, there is a risk of scarring, venous stenosis, potential loss of valuable access as well as the risk of infection. Method We report a retrospective review of our experience using tunnelled line intraluminal plasty (TuLIP) in 11 patients over 16 months with fibrin sheath formation on pre-existing tunnelled haemodialysis catheters. Result All patients responded well to treatment with median line patency post TuLIP reaching 112 days. Conclusion TuLIP may have a role in extending catheter lifespan and delaying more invasive intervention.

Kennard AL, Walters GD, Jiang SH, Talaulikar GS. Interventions for treating central venous haemodialysis catheter malfunction. Cochrane Database Syst Rev 2017; 10:CD011953. [PMID: 29106711 PMCID: PMC6485653 DOI: 10.1002/14651858.cd011953.pub2] [Citation(s) in RCA: 10]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/07/2022]
Abstract
BACKGROUND Adequate haemodialysis (HD) in people with end-stage kidney disease (ESKD) is reliant upon establishment of vascular access, which may consist of arteriovenous fistula, arteriovenous graft, or central venous catheters (CVC). Although discouraged due to high rates of infectious and thrombotic complications as well as technical issues that limit their life span, CVC have the significant advantage of being immediately usable and are the only means of vascular access in a significant number of patients. Previous studies have established the role of thrombolytic agents (TLA) in the prevention of catheter malfunction. Systematic review of different thrombolytic agents has also identified their utility in restoration of catheter patency following catheter malfunction. To date the use and efficacy of fibrin sheath stripping and catheter exchange have not been evaluated against thrombolytic agents. OBJECTIVES This review aimed to evaluate the benefits and harms of TLA, preparations, doses and administration as well as fibrin-sheath stripping, over-the-wire catheter exchange or any other intervention proposed for management of tunnelled CVC malfunction in patients with ESKD on HD. SEARCH METHODS We searched the Cochrane Kidney and Transplant Specialised Register up to 17 August 2017 through contact with the Information Specialist using search terms relevant to this review. Studies in the Specialised Register are identified through searches of CENTRAL, MEDLINE, and EMBASE, conference proceedings, the International Clinical Trials Register (ICTRP) Search Portal, and ClinicalTrials.gov. SELECTION CRITERIA We included all studies conducted in people with ESKD who rely on tunnelled CVC for either initiation or maintenance of HD access and who require restoration of catheter patency following late-onset catheter malfunction and evaluated the role of TLA, fibrin sheath stripping or over-the-wire catheter exchange to restore catheter function. The primary outcome was be restoration of line patency defined as ≥ 300 mL/min or adequate to complete a HD session or as defined by the study authors. Secondary outcomes included dialysis adequacy and adverse outcomes. DATA COLLECTION AND ANALYSIS Two authors independently assessed retrieved studies to determine which studies satisfy the inclusion criteria and carried out data extraction. Included studies were assessed for risk of bias. Summary estimates of effect were obtained using a random-effects model, and results were expressed as risk ratios (RR) and their 95% confidence intervals (CI) for dichotomous outcomes, and mean difference (MD) and 95% CI for continuous outcomes. Confidence in the evidence was assessed using GRADE. MAIN RESULTS Our search strategy identified 8 studies (580 participants) as eligible for inclusion in this review. Interventions included: thrombolytic therapy versus placebo (1 study); low versus high dose thrombolytic therapy (1); alteplase versus urokinase (1); short versus long thrombolytic dwell (1); thrombolytic therapy versus percutaneous fibrin sheath stripping (1); fibrin sheath stripping versus over-the-wire catheter exchange (1); and over-the-wire catheter exchange versus exchange with and without angioplasty sheath disruption (1). No two studies compared the same interventions. Most studies had a high risk of bias due to poor study design, broad inclusion criteria, low patient numbers and industry involvement.Based on low certainty evidence, thrombolytic therapy may restore catheter function when compared to placebo (149 participants: RR 4.05, 95% CI 1.42 to 11.56) but there is no data available to suggest an optimal dose or administration method. The certainty of this evidence is reduced due to the fact that it is based on only a single study with wide confidence limits, high risk of bias and imprecision in the estimates of adverse events (149 participants: RR 2.03, 95% CI 0.38 to 10.73).Based on the available evidence, physical disruption of a fibrin sheath using interventional radiology techniques appears to be equally efficacious as the use of a pharmaceutical thrombolytic agent for the immediate management of dysfunctional catheters (57 participants: RR 0.92, 95% CI 0.80 to 1.07).Catheter patency is poor following use of thrombolytic agents with studies reporting median catheter survival rates of 14 to 42 days and was reported to improve significantly by fibrin sheath stripping or catheter exchange (37 participants: MD -27.70 days, 95% CI -51.00 to -4.40). Catheter exchange was reported to be superior to sheath disruption with respect to catheter survival (30 participants: MD 213.00 days, 95% CI 205.70 to 220.30).There is insufficient evidence to suggest any specific intervention is superior in terms of ensuring either dialysis adequacy or reduced risk of adverse events. AUTHORS' CONCLUSIONS Thrombolysis, fibrin sheath disruption and over-the-wire catheter exchange are effective and appropriate therapies for immediately restoring catheter patency in dysfunctional cuffed and tunnelled HD catheters. On current data there is no evidence to support physical intervention over the use of pharmaceutical agents in the acute setting. Pharmacological interventions appear to have a bridging role and long-term catheter survival may be improved by fibrin sheath disruption and is probably superior following catheter exchange. There is no evidence favouring any of these approaches with respect to dialysis adequacy or risk of adverse events.The current review is limited by the small number of available studies with limited numbers of patients enrolled. Most of the studies included in this review were judged to have a high risk of bias and were potentially influenced by pharmaceutical industry involvement.Further research is required to adequately address the question of the most efficacious and clinically appropriate technique for HD catheter dysfunction.
